In microbiology, the disc diffusion method is a technique used to evaluate the effectiveness of antibiotics against bacteria. This method involves placing antibiotic-impregnated paper discs on an agar plate inoculated with the bacteria in question. As the bacteria grow, the antibiotic diffuses from the disc into the agar, inhibiting bacterial growth in a surrounding zone.

This test is commonly referred to as the Kirby Bauer test. It is widely used due to its simplicity, cost-effectiveness, and the ability to compare multiple antibiotics simultaneously.
